Macquarie University Online Application
Macquarie University has an online application manager that allows you to apply for various courses and programs offered by the university. You can use this portal to:
- Submit your application and supporting documents
- Track the status of your application
- Accept or decline your offer
- Enrol in your classes
- Update your personal details
To access the online application manager, you need to create an account and log in with your username and password. You can also apply through an authorised agent or via Universities Admissions Centre (UAC) International if you are an international student currently completing an Australian Year 12 qualification, the International Baccalaureate (IB), or the New Zealand NCEA Level 3 qualification.
Macquarie University Eligibility for Admission
To be eligible for admission to Macquarie University, you need to meet the academic and English language requirements for your chosen course or program. The requirements may vary depending on the level and field of study, as well as your country of origin and previous qualifications.
You can find the specific entry requirements for each course or program on the Macquarie University Course Finder page. You can also use the Entry Requirements Calculator to check your eligibility based on your academic results.
In addition to the academic and English language requirements, you may also need to meet other criteria such as:
- Prerequisites or assumed knowledge
- Portfolio or audition
- Interview or test
- Adjustment factors or bonus points
- Recognition of prior learning (RPL)
